Output 517eefcee992fa3d5ba9c454c0fa6b2c09491c094d6086e20cf41fbd5abb367e:1

value
50113137
script pubkey
OP_0 OP_PUSHBYTES_20 def456c71ea6017373a315b104dcf4d26ae10308
address
bc1qmm69d3c75cqhxuarzkcsfh856f4wzqcgtjtdte
transaction
517eefcee992fa3d5ba9c454c0fa6b2c09491c094d6086e20cf41fbd5abb367e
confirmations
83436
spent
true